Summary:碩士 === 雲林科技大學 === 通訊工程研究所碩士班 === 96 === H.264/AVC Intra Prediction the next generation of technology to provide a lot of the Prediction model and best of the distortion rate (Rate-Distortion Optimization, RDO) , but it’s brings the complexity and computation load increase drastically. The calculation reduce of the Intra Prediction H.264/AVC related research is very important. This paper presents a fast mode decision algorithm for H.264/AVC called Early Detection for Intra Prediction (EDIP) to reduce the amount of computation, this paper using various methods such as: IPCM detection, smooth block detection, SAD (Sum of the Absolute Differences) detection to reduce the amount of computation. Early Detection for Intra Prediction (EDIP) algorithm compared with H.264/AVC JM 10.2 standard version, this paper methods to reduce the average 71 % of the computation, while the average price is PSNR slight decline of about 0.066 dB, and Bitrate average increase of about 2.353 %.
